Climate Compatibility

Austin, Texas, experiences a humid subtropical climate, characterized by hot summers and mild winters. When selecting hibiscus mallow and other plants for your landscape, it’s essential to consider their ability to thrive in these conditions. Hibiscus mallow, with its tolerance for heat and humidity, makes an excellent choice for Austin’s climate.

Consider partnering hibiscus mallow with other plants that are well-suited to the local climate. Native Texas plants such as lantana, salvia, and black-eyed Susan are great companions for hibiscus mallow, as they share similar water and sunlight requirements.

Selecting the Right Variety of Hibiscus Mallow

When choosing hibiscus mallow for your landscape, consider the specific variety that will thrive in Austin’s climate. Texas Star hibiscus mallow, with its vibrant red blooms and resilience in high temperatures, is an excellent choice for creating a striking focal point in your landscape. The Luna Pink Swirl variety also thrives in Austin’s climate, offering stunning pink and white blooms that add a pop of color to any outdoor space.

It’s important to select hibiscus mallow varieties that are known for their heat tolerance and resistance to common pests and diseases in the area. Creating a Harmonious Plant Combination

Incorporating hibiscus mallow into your landscape design requires careful consideration of its compatibility with other plants. When selecting companion plants, aim for a harmonious balance of colors, textures, and growth habits. Pairing hibiscus mallow with butterfly weed, purple coneflower, and Mexican bush sage can create a visually engaging combination while promoting biodiversity in your landscape.

Consider the overall visual impact of the plant combination throughout the growing season. Selecting plants with staggered blooming times ensures that your landscape remains vibrant and inviting year-round. Additionally, pay attention to the differing sunlight and water requirements of each plant to maximize their potential and ensure long-term success.

Maximizing Plant Health and Longevity

After selecting the right combination of plants for your Austin, Texas landscape, it’s crucial to prioritize their ongoing care and maintenance. Proper watering, fertilization, and pest management are essential for ensuring the health and longevity of hibiscus mallow and its companion plants.

In Austin’s hot climate, providing adequate water is key to supporting plant growth and resilience. Implementing a drip irrigation system or utilizing water-conserving techniques, such as mulching and efficient watering practices, can help maintain optimal moisture levels for hibiscus mallow and its companion plants.

Regularly inspecting plants for signs of pests and diseases can prevent potential issues from escalating and impacting the overall health of the landscape.
